><The recipient "[log in to unmask]"  is not acceptable to your SMTP
>server.  The messsage is not sendable until the recipient has been changed.>

This message means your service provider will not accept mail for SMTP
relay (as an anti-spam measure).  Usually this happens when you are dialed
up to one provider, but reading your mail off another provider and then
attempting to send mail via that provider.  (If you were dialed up inside
them this would not happen).  Contact your provider for more assistance.
